94 s10 2.2 head gasket help??? Anyone
I have a 94 s10 with a 2.2. In the link below I purchased the felpro head gasket which is missing alot of the water ports. The one pictured below that is like the one I took off. Should I go ahead and install the felpro or return it?

i just did this very job on the same truck, 94' 2.2. I milled the head (highly recommended) and installed new head bolts too. be very careful with the exhaust bolts they can very easily pull the threads out of the head. torque head to 44# on small bolts and 50# large bolts, i believe.

Ive done the same job and the parts I used came from Carquest and were like for like. The gaskets were the same. New head bolts are a must and it went back togeher with no issues. This little turd motor does not tolerate overheating very well.
